USB: Adding YC Cable USB Serial device to pl2303

This simply adds the "YC Cable" as a vendor and its pl2303-based
USB<->Serial adapter as a product.  This particular adapter is sold by
Radio Shack.  I've done limited testing on a few different systems with
no issues.
